I have a data table consisting of deferral schedules from which I need to create a table showing transactions for each schedule by period, based on a date slicer.
If the schedule document date is less or equal to the selected date, the schedule and all transactions related to it must be included in the report. If the schedule is in the future (i.e. greater than the selected date, it must not be included.
A shedule has a transaction line number of 0, while the transactions of the schedule have transaction lines from1 onwards.
Below I have an example of the data file and two scenarios, each having a different selection date.
My problem is when I reference the selection table. I am unable to use a filter (to select only those current and past schedules) when calculating the Trans Amt for each specific period. My date slicer is set to 'Before', and the calculation used for each period is :
